  1. Baraboo (/ ˈ b ɛər ə b uː / BAIR-ə-boo) is the largest city in and the county seat of Sauk County, Wisconsin, United States. The largest city in the county, Baraboo is the principal city of the Baraboo Micropolitan Statistical Area which comprises a portion of the Madison Combined Statistical area. Its 2020 population was 12,556.

  5. 17 de feb. de 2024 · Baraboo, city, south-central Wisconsin, U.S., lying in a hilly region on the Baraboo River, about 35 miles (55 km) northwest of Madison. Baraboo is best known as the home of the Ringling brothers and the birthplace (1884) of the Ringling Brothers Circus, celebrated in the city’s Circus World Museum.
